aktueller Standort:Heim > Technische Artikel > Backend-Entwicklung

  • Welche Vorteile bietet die Verwendung eines Java-Frameworks zur Implementierung einer kontinuierlichen Überwachung in DevOps?
    Welche Vorteile bietet die Verwendung eines Java-Frameworks zur Implementierung einer kontinuierlichen Überwachung in DevOps?
    Vorteile des Java-Frameworks für die Implementierung kontinuierlicher Überwachung in DevOps: Echtzeit-Sichtbarkeit: Bietet Echtzeit-Einblicke in die Anwendungsleistung und den Zustand. Automatisierte Fehlererkennung: Erkennen Sie Leistungsengpässe und Fehler automatisch und reduzieren Sie so den Aufwand der manuellen Überwachung. End-to-End-Tracing: Gewinnen Sie Einblicke in den Anwendungsverkehr und die Latenz, um Systemengpässe zu erkennen und die Leistung zu optimieren. Verbessern Sie die Entwicklungseffizienz: Helfen Sie Entwicklern, die Anwendungsqualität zu verbessern, indem Sie Fehler isolieren und Code optimieren.
    javaLernprogramm . spring 1112 2024-06-01 12:53:56
  • Wie soll Parallelität im Java-Framework gehandhabt werden?
    Wie soll Parallelität im Java-Framework gehandhabt werden?
    Wichtige Richtlinien zur Vermeidung von Deadlocks und Race Conditions in Java-Frameworks: Gewährleisten Sie die Thread-Sicherheit, um Konflikte mit gemeinsam genutzten Ressourcen zu verhindern. Verwenden Sie Parallelitätssperren, um gemeinsam genutzte Ressourcen in Multithread-Umgebungen zu schützen. Verwenden Sie atomare Operationen, um korrekte Aktualisierungen für unteilbare Operationen sicherzustellen. Optimieren Sie die Leistung und verhindern Sie die Erschöpfung von Ressourcen mit der Thread-Pool-Verwaltung. Erwägen Sie die asynchrone Programmierung, um Aufgaben mit langer Laufzeit auszuführen, ohne den Hauptthread zu blockieren.
    javaLernprogramm . spring 382 2024-06-01 12:47:56
  • Wie finde ich Dokumentation und Tutorials zum Java-Framework?
    Wie finde ich Dokumentation und Tutorials zum Java-Framework?
    Zu den Möglichkeiten, Dokumentation und Tutorials zum Java-Framework zu finden, gehören: Offizielle Website: Die genaueste und aktuellste Informationsquelle mit Dokumentation und Tutorials. MavenCentral: Stellt Framework-Dokumentation bereit und verteilt sie über MavenCentral. Javadoc: Generieren Sie automatisch Dokumentation, um Klassen- und Methodeninformationen bereitzustellen. Beispielprojekt: Demonstriert die Funktionalität und Nutzung des Frameworks, einschließlich anschaulichem Code und Konfiguration. Community-Foren und StackOverflow: bieten Diskussionen über Probleme und Support.
    javaLernprogramm . spring 393 2024-06-01 12:44:56
  • Was sind die Anwendungstrends neuer Java-Frameworks in der Microservice-Architektur?
    Was sind die Anwendungstrends neuer Java-Frameworks in der Microservice-Architektur?
    Mit dem Aufkommen der Microservice-Architektur wurden darin in großem Umfang neue Java-Frameworks verwendet, darunter hauptsächlich: Quarkus: native Kompilierung, Reduzierung der Startzeit und Verbesserung der Leistung. Helidon: leicht, zusammensetzbar, auf Reaktionsfähigkeit und Effizienz ausgerichtet. SpringBoot: Vereinfacht die Entwicklung und bietet automatische Konfigurations- und Abhängigkeitsverwaltung. Micronaut: schneller Start, geringer Ressourcenverbrauch, nutzt AOT zur Generierung nativer Binärdateien. Die Auswahl des richtigen Frameworks sollte auf Faktoren wie Anwendungsanforderungen, Entwicklungsumgebung, Zusammensetzbarkeit des Frameworks, Entwicklerfähigkeiten usw. basieren.
    javaLernprogramm . spring 326 2024-06-01 12:32:57
  • Cloud-native Transformation, wie meistert das Java-Framework neue Herausforderungen?
    Cloud-native Transformation, wie meistert das Java-Framework neue Herausforderungen?
    Die Cloud-native Transformation bringt neue Herausforderungen für Java-Frameworks mit sich, darunter: Service Discovery, Container-Lifecycle-Management, unveränderliche Infrastruktur, Elastizität, Skalierbarkeit, Hochverfügbarkeit und reaktive Programmierung. Um diesen Herausforderungen zu begegnen, bietet das Java-Framework Service-Discovery-Tools (wie Eureka, Consul), Container-Orchestrierungsintegration (wie Kubernetes, DockerCompose), elastische Mechanismen (wie Circuit-Breaker-Modus, Wiederholungsmechanismus) und reaktionsfähige APIs (wie WebFlux). ), usw. Funktion. Diese Funktionen ermöglichen es Entwicklern, robuste und skalierbare Cloud-native Java-Anwendungen zu erstellen.
    javaLernprogramm . spring 766 2024-06-01 12:29:56
  • Wie wählen Sie das beste Java-Framework für Ihre spezifischen Anforderungen aus?
    Wie wählen Sie das beste Java-Framework für Ihre spezifischen Anforderungen aus?
    Die Auswahl des besten Frameworks für Ihre Java-Anwendung erfordert die Berücksichtigung des Anwendungstyps, der Skalierbarkeit, der Community-Unterstützung, der Lizenzierung und der praktischen Anwendungsfälle. Zu den gängigen Frameworks gehören: Spring Framework (Webentwicklung auf Unternehmensebene), Hibernate (Persistenz), JUnit (Testen), Log4j (Protokollierung) und Jackson (Datenbindung).
    javaLernprogramm . spring 340 2024-06-01 12:21:58
  • Welche Gemeinsamkeiten und Unterschiede gibt es in den Mechanismen verschiedener Java-Frameworks zur Verbesserung der Entwicklungseffizienz?
    Welche Gemeinsamkeiten und Unterschiede gibt es in den Mechanismen verschiedener Java-Frameworks zur Verbesserung der Entwicklungseffizienz?
    Die Mechanismen, mit denen Spring- und JSF-Frameworks die Entwicklungseffizienz verbessern, sind wie folgt: Spring: Abhängigkeitsinjektion und Aspektprogrammierung JSF: Deklarative Schnittstelle und Komponentenbibliothek Ähnlichkeiten und Unterschiede: Abhängigkeitsinjektion: Spring verwendet sie, JSF verwendet keine deklarative Schnittstelle: JSF verwendet sie , aber Spring verwendet keine Komponentenbibliothek: Spring wird von JSF bereitgestellt und konzentriert sich hauptsächlich auf die Abhängigkeitsinjektion. Gleiche Punkte: Java-Kompatibilität vereinfacht die Unterstützung der Entwicklungsgemeinschaft
    javaLernprogramm . spring 790 2024-06-01 12:18:56
  • Welche Rolle spielen Java-Frameworks bei der Lösung geschäftlicher Komplexität?
    Welche Rolle spielen Java-Frameworks bei der Lösung geschäftlicher Komplexität?
    Java-Frameworks vereinfachen die Entwicklung komplexer Anwendungen durch die Bereitstellung von Komponenten und Entwurfsmustern. Die MVC-Architektur unterteilt die Anwendungslogik in Modelle, Ansichten und Controller und verbessert so die Wartbarkeit und Skalierbarkeit. Das Spring-Framework ist ein beliebtes Java-Framework, das ein vollständiges MVC-Framework für Konfiguration, Abhängigkeitsinjektion und Transaktionsverwaltung bereitstellt. In praktischen Anwendungen vereinfacht SpringMVC die Verbindung zwischen Ansichten, Controllern und Modellen und übernimmt die Weiterleitung von Anforderungen und die Datenbindung. Java-Frameworks vereinfachen die Anwendungskomplexität und ermöglichen es Entwicklern, sich auf die Geschäftslogik zu konzentrieren und robuste und wartbare Anwendungen zu erstellen.
    javaLernprogramm . spring 898 2024-06-01 12:09:56
  • Wie verhindert das Java-Framework Parametermanipulationen?
    Wie verhindert das Java-Framework Parametermanipulationen?
    Im Java-Framework gehören zu den Best Practices zur Verhinderung von Parametermanipulationen die Verwendung von SpringValidation zur Überprüfung von Anforderungsparametereinschränkungen. Verwenden Sie JacksonAnnotations, um das Serialisierungs- und Deserialisierungsverhalten zu steuern. Aktivieren Sie den CSRF-Schutz, um Cross-Site-Request-Forgery-Angriffe zu verhindern. Verwenden Sie die Parameterbereinigung, um Anforderungsparameter zu filtern und zu validieren. Praktisches Beispiel: Verhindern Sie, dass Benutzer die Konten anderer Personen aktualisieren, indem Sie Feldaktualisierungen validieren und einschränken.
    javaLernprogramm . spring 1173 2024-06-01 12:02:56
  • Vergleich der Erfahrungen mit Java-Frameworks in Projekten unterschiedlicher Größe
    Vergleich der Erfahrungen mit Java-Frameworks in Projekten unterschiedlicher Größe
    Für Java-Projekte unterschiedlicher Größe hängt die Wahl des besten Frameworks von den Projektanforderungen ab: Kleine Projekte: Spring bietet sowohl einfache als auch Kernfunktionen. Mittelgroße Projekte: Hibernate bietet starke ORM-Unterstützung. Große Projekte: JPA bietet standardisierte und besser skalierbare ORM-Lösungen.
    javaLernprogramm . spring 694 2024-06-01 11:54:56
  • Tipps zur Leistungsoptimierung für Java-Frameworks
    Tipps zur Leistungsoptimierung für Java-Frameworks
    Tipps zur Leistungsoptimierung des Java-Frameworks: Verwenden Sie leichte Frameworks, um Abhängigkeiten zu reduzieren. Aktivieren Sie die Cache-Optimierung. Parallele Verarbeitung von Datenbankabfragen. Konfigurieren Sie die Serverüberwachung und -analyse
    javaLernprogramm . spring 787 2024-06-01 11:46:58
  • Welche Vorteile bietet das Java-Framework bei der Schulung und dem Coaching von Teammitgliedern?
    Welche Vorteile bietet das Java-Framework bei der Schulung und dem Coaching von Teammitgliedern?
    Zu den Vorteilen von Java-Frameworks bei der Schulung und dem Coaching von Teammitgliedern gehört die Bereitstellung klarer Richtlinien und Best Practices für Entwickler, um die Konsistenz und Qualität des Codes sicherzustellen. Standardisieren Sie Kommunikation und Zusammenarbeit und reduzieren Sie Verwirrung, indem Sie dieselben Architektur- und Namenskonventionen befolgen. Reduzieren Sie den Lernaufwand und machen Sie neue Mitglieder schnell auf den neuesten Stand, indem Sie bereits vorhandenen Code und Bibliotheken nutzen.
    javaLernprogramm . spring 773 2024-06-01 11:45:57
  • Welche Funktionen machen das Java-Framework zur ersten Wahl für fortgeschrittene Entwickler?
    Welche Funktionen machen das Java-Framework zur ersten Wahl für fortgeschrittene Entwickler?
    Das Java-Framework ist aufgrund der folgenden Funktionen zur ersten Wahl für fortgeschrittene Entwickler geworden: Modularität und Wiederverwendbarkeit: Ermöglicht die Wiederverwendung von Code und reduziert die Wartungskosten. Abhängigkeitsmanagement: Automatisieren Sie das Management, um Konflikte und Fehler zu reduzieren. Test- und Debugging-Unterstützung: Vereinfachen Sie Tests und Debugging, um die Anwendungsqualität zu verbessern. Aspektorientierte Programmierung: Fügen Sie Funktionen wie Protokollierung und Berechtigungsprüfungen hinzu, ohne den Kerncode zu ändern.
    javaLernprogramm . spring 383 2024-06-01 11:37:57
  • Die Essenz der Java-Microservice-Architektur
    Die Essenz der Java-Microservice-Architektur
    Die Java-Microservices-Architektur ist ein Softwarearchitekturansatz, der Anwendungen in lose gekoppelte, unabhängig bereitgestellte Microservices zerlegt. Zu den Schlüsseltechnologien gehören SpringBoot, SpringCloud und ApacheKafka. Zu den Vorteilen gehören Flexibilität, Skalierbarkeit und unabhängige Bereitstellung. In einer E-Commerce-Website kann diese Architektur Funktionen in die Microservices ProductService, OrderService und UserService aufteilen und über Apache Kafka kommunizieren. Diese Architektur bietet die Vorteile einer einfachen Änderung, Erweiterung und unabhängigen Bereitstellung.
    javaLernprogramm . spring 368 2024-06-01 11:33:57
  • Wie erfüllen Java-Frameworks die sich ändernden Anforderungen in DevOps?
    Wie erfüllen Java-Frameworks die sich ändernden Anforderungen in DevOps?
    Das Java-Framework erfüllt die Anforderungen von DevOps auf folgende Weise: SpringBoot vereinfacht die Microservice-Entwicklung und stellt Automatisierungs- und Testtools bereit. JakartaEE bietet standardisierte und skalierbare Dienste für Anwendungen auf Unternehmensebene. ApacheCamel vereinfacht die Anwendungsintegration und beseitigt Komplexität.
    javaLernprogramm . spring 625 2024-06-01 11:32:56

Werkzeugempfehlungen

Kontaktcode für das jQuery-Enterprise-Nachrichtenformular

Der Kontaktcode für das jQuery-Unternehmensnachrichtenformular ist ein einfacher und praktischer Unternehmensnachrichtenformular- und Kontaktcode für die Einführungsseite.

Wiedergabeeffekte für HTML5-MP3-Spieluhren

Der Spezialeffekt „HTML5 MP3-Musikbox-Wiedergabe“ ist ein MP3-Musikplayer, der auf HTML5+CSS3 basiert, um niedliche Musikbox-Emoticons zu erstellen und auf die Schaltfläche „Umschalten“ zu klicken.

HTML5 coole Partikelanimations-Navigationsmenü-Spezialeffekte

Der Spezialeffekt „HTML5 Cool Particle Animation“ für das Navigationsmenü ist ein Spezialeffekt, der seine Farbe ändert, wenn die Maus über das Navigationsmenü bewegt wird.
Menünavigation
2024-02-29

Drag-and-Drop-Bearbeitungscode für visuelle jQuery-Formulare

Der Drag-and-Drop-Bearbeitungscode für visuelle jQuery-Formulare ist eine visuelle Form, die auf jQuery und dem Bootstrap-Framework basiert.

Webvorlage für Bio-Obst- und Gemüselieferanten Bootstrap5

Eine Webvorlage für Bio-Obst- und Gemüselieferanten – Bootstrap5
Bootstrap-Vorlage
2023-02-03

Bootstrap3 multifunktionale Dateninformations-Hintergrundverwaltung, responsive Webseitenvorlage – Novus

Bootstrap3 multifunktionale Dateninformations-Hintergrundverwaltung, responsive Webseitenvorlage – Novus
Backend-Vorlage
2023-02-02

Webseitenvorlage für die Immobilienressourcen-Serviceplattform Bootstrap5

Webseitenvorlage für die Immobilienressourcen-Serviceplattform Bootstrap5
Bootstrap-Vorlage
2023-02-02

Einfache Webvorlage für Lebenslaufinformationen Bootstrap4

Einfache Webvorlage für Lebenslaufinformationen Bootstrap4
Bootstrap-Vorlage
2023-02-02

可爱的夏天元素矢量素材(EPS+PNG)

这是一款可爱的夏天元素矢量素材,包含了太阳、遮阳帽、椰子树、比基尼、飞机、西瓜、冰淇淋、雪糕、冷饮、游泳圈、人字拖、菠萝、海螺、贝壳、海星、螃蟹、柠檬、防晒霜、太阳镜等等,素材提供了 EPS 和免扣 PNG 两种格式,含 JPG 预览图。
PNG material
2024-05-09

四个红的的 2023 毕业徽章矢量素材(AI+EPS+PNG)

这是一款红的的 2023 毕业徽章矢量素材,共四个,提供了 AI 和 EPS 和免扣 PNG 等格式,含 JPG 预览图。
PNG material
2024-02-29

唱歌的小鸟和装满花朵的推车设计春天banner矢量素材(AI+EPS)

这是一款由唱歌的小鸟和装满花朵的推车设计的春天 banner 矢量素材,提供了 AI 和 EPS 两种格式,含 JPG 预览图。
Banner image
2024-02-29

金色的毕业帽矢量素材(EPS+PNG)

这是一款金色的毕业帽矢量素材,提供了 EPS 和免扣 PNG 两种格式,含 JPG 预览图。
PNG material
2024-02-27

Website-Vorlage für Reinigungs- und Reparaturdienste für Inneneinrichtungen

Die Website-Vorlage für Reinigungs- und Wartungsdienste für Heimdekoration ist ein Website-Vorlagen-Download, der sich für Werbewebsites eignet, die Heimdekorations-, Reinigungs-, Wartungs- und andere Dienstleistungsorganisationen anbieten. Tipp: Diese Vorlage ruft die Google-Schriftartenbibliothek auf und die Seite wird möglicherweise langsam geöffnet.
Frontend-Vorlage
2024-05-09

Persönliche Lebenslauf-Leitfaden-Seitenvorlage in frischen Farben

Die Vorlage „Fresh Color Matching“ für die Lebenslauf-Leitfadenseite für persönliche Bewerbungen ist eine persönliche Webvorlage zum Herunterladen von Lebensläufen für die Jobsuche, die für einen frischen Farbabstimmungsstil geeignet ist. Tipp: Diese Vorlage ruft die Google-Schriftartenbibliothek auf und die Seite wird möglicherweise langsam geöffnet.
Frontend-Vorlage
2024-02-29

Web-Vorlage für kreativen Job-Lebenslauf für Designer

Die Webvorlage „Designer Creative Job Resume“ ist eine herunterladbare Webvorlage für die Anzeige persönlicher Lebensläufe, die für verschiedene Designerpositionen geeignet ist. Tipp: Diese Vorlage ruft die Google-Schriftartenbibliothek auf und die Seite wird möglicherweise langsam geöffnet.
Frontend-Vorlage
2024-02-28

Website-Vorlage eines modernen Ingenieurbauunternehmens

Die Website-Vorlage für moderne Ingenieur- und Bauunternehmen ist eine herunterladbare Website-Vorlage, die sich zur Förderung der Ingenieur- und Baudienstleistungsbranche eignet. Tipp: Diese Vorlage ruft die Google-Schriftartenbibliothek auf und die Seite wird möglicherweise langsam geöffnet.
Frontend-Vorlage
2024-02-28